This Schedule 13D/A constitutes Amendment No. 2 (“Amendment No. 2”) to the Schedule 13D filed by Mr. Jian Tang, Igomax Inc., Mr. Wing Hong Sammy Hsieh and Bubinga Holdings Limited (collectively, the “Reporting Persons”) on December 22, 2022, as previously amended and supplemented by the amendment filed as of July 7, 2023 (as amended to date, the “Original Schedule 13D”), relating to Class A ordinary shares, par value $0.001 per share (the “Class A Ordinary Shares” and together with Class B ordinary shares, par value $0.001 per share, the “Ordinary Shares”), and American Depositary Shares, each representing five Class A Ordinary Shares (the “ADSs”) of iClick Interactive Asia Group Limited, a company incorporated in the Cayman Islands (the “Issuer”).

Item 3. Source and Amount of Funds or Other Consideration.

Item 3 in the Original Schedule 13D is amended and supplemented by inserting the following:

On November 24, 2023, the Issuer entered into an Agreement and Plan of Merger (the “Merger Agreement”) with TSH Investment Holding Limited, an exempted company with limited liability incorporated under the laws of the Cayman Islands (“Parent”) and TSH Merger Sub Limited, an exempted company with limited liability incorporated under the laws of the Cayman Islands and a wholly-owned subsidiary of Parent (“Merger Sub”), pursuant to which, and subject to the terms and conditions thereof, Merger Sub will merge with and into the Issuer, with the Issuer continuing as the surviving company and becoming a wholly-owned subsidiary of Parent (the “Merger”). It is anticipated that the Buyer Group will fund the Merger through a combination of (i) equity financing provided by the Sponsor (as defined below) in an aggregate amount of up to US$8,000,000 in cash pursuant to the Equity Commitment Letter (as defined below), (ii) rollover financing comprised of the Rollover Shares (as defined below) pursuant to the Support Agreement (as defined below), and (iii) debt financing provided by New Age SP II (the “Lender”) pursuant to a facility agreement, dated as of November 24, 2023 (the “Facility Agreement”), by and between Merger Sub and Lender. Item 4. Purpose of Transaction.

Item 4 in the Original Schedule 13D is amended and supplemented by inserting the following:

On November 24, 2023, the Issuer announced in a press release that it had entered into the Merger Agreement with Parent and Merger Sub, pursuant to which, and subject to the terms and conditions thereof, Merger Sub will merge with and into the Issuer, with the Issuer continuing as the surviving company and becoming a wholly-owned subsidiary of Parent.

Pursuant to the Merger Agreement, at the effective time of the Merger (the “Effective Time”), each Ordinary Share issued and outstanding immediately prior to the Effective Time, will be cancelled in exchange for the right to receive US$0.816 in cash per Ordinary Share without interest, except for (i) the Ordinary Shares held by Parent and Merger Sub, (ii) the Ordinary Shares held by the Issuer and any of its subsidiaries or in its treasury, (iii) the Ordinary Shares owned by Jianjun Huang, Marine Central Limited, Creative Big Limited, Cheer Lead Global Limited, Huge Superpower Limited, Capable Excel Limited, Infinity Global Fund SPC, Integrated Asset Management (Asia) Limited, Chan Nai Hang, Likeable Limited, Tsang Hing Sze, Lau Ying Wai, Chik Yu Chung Roni, Tse Kok Yu Ryan, Imen Pang, Zhao Yong, Yang Xin and the Reporting Persons (such shareholders collectively, the “Rollover Shareholders”, and such Ordinary Shares, the “Rollover Shares”), (iv) the Ordinary Shares held by the


Issuer and the depositary of the Issuer’s ADS program and reserved for issuance and allocation pursuant to the Issuer’s share incentive plan ((i) – (iv), collectively, the “Excluded Shares”), and (v) the Ordinary Shares that are held by shareholders who have validly exercised and not effectively withdrawn or lost their rights to dissent from the Merger pursuant to Section 238 of Companies Act (Revised) of the Cayman Islands (the “Dissenting Shares”). Immediately prior to the effective time of the Merger, the Rollover Shares will be cancelled for no cash consideration, and the Rollover Shareholders will subscribe for or otherwise receive newly issued shares of Parent. Each Dissenting Share issued and outstanding immediately prior to the Effective Time will be cancelled for the right to receive the fair value of such Shares determined in accordance with, the provisions of Section 238 of the Companies Act (Revised) of the Cayman Islands.

Each ADS issued and outstanding immediately prior to the Effective Time (other than ADSs representing the Excluded Shares), together with each Ordinary Share represented by such ADSs, will be cancelled in exchange for the right to receive US$4.08 in cash per ADS without interest.

The Merger, which is currently expected to close in the first quarter, 2024, is subject to customary closing conditions including an affirmative vote of shareholders representing at least two-thirds of the voting power of the outstanding Ordinary Shares present and voting in person or by proxy at a meeting of the Issuer’s shareholders. The purpose of Transactions (as defined below), including the Merger, is to acquire all of the shares of the Ordinary Shares held by shareholders of the Issuer other than the Rollover Shares.

Following consummation of the Merger, the Issuer will become a wholly-owned subsidiary of the Parent. In addition, if the Merger is consummated, the Issuer will be privately-held by the Reporting Persons and the other Rollover Shareholders and its ADSs will no longer be listed on the Nasdaq Global Market.

Concurrently with the execution of the Merger Agreement:

(1) Parent and the Rollover Shareholders executed a support agreement (the “Support Agreement”), pursuant to which, each of the Rollover Shareholders has agreed to, subject to the terms and conditions set forth therein and among other obligations, (i) the cancellation of the Rollover Shares held by such Rollover Shareholders for no cash consideration, (ii) subscribe for newly issued ordinary shares of Parent immediately prior to the closing of the Merger, (iii) vote in favor of authorization and approval of the Merger Agreement and the transactions contemplated by the Merger Agreement (the “Transactions”), including the Merger; and (iv) against any proposals or actions inconsistent or interfering with the Transactions;

(2) Parent, Mr. Huang and Rise Chain Investment Limited, which is wholly owned by Mr. Huang (“Rise Chain,” and together with Mr. Huang, the “Sponsor”), entered into an equity commitment letter (the “Equity Commitment Letter”), pursuant to which the Sponsor committed to invest up to US$8,000,000 in aggregate in cash as equity financing in connection with the Merger;

(3) Rise Chain executed a limited guarantee in favor of the Issuer with respect to certain obligations of Parent under the Merger Agreement (the “Limited Guarantee”), guaranteeing certain of Parent’s and Merger Sub’s obligations under the Merger Agreement; and

(4) The Buyer Group, Parent and Merger Sub entered into an interim investors agreement (the “Interim Investors Agreement”) in order to establish terms and conditions that will govern, among other matters, the actions of Parent and Merger Sub and the relationship among the Buyer Group with respect to the Merger Agreement and the Transactions.
